#3235d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3235d6 is composed of 19.6% red, 20.8%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#3235d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#646aff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3235d6 color description : Strong blue.

#3235d6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3235d6 has RGB values of R:50, G:53,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3290582.

Shades and Tints of #3235d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020208 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3235d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7e8a is the less saturated color, while #0c11fc is the most saturated one.
